3651% Return On Investment
Three THOUSAND percent ROI. Is it possible? It is when your investment is little more than a can of paint! The brilliant marketing tactic you are about to see is probably not something you can plug directly into your business. Unfortunately. I am sharing it you for another reason altogether, which I will explain at the end. I had Read More …